    Principal Fisheries Officer

    Job Responsibilities

    • Managing fish breeding programs, fish feeding formulation and pond management programs
    • Inspecting fish handling facilities on the farms
    • Ensuring compliance with existing fish/fishery products handling regulations
    • Monitoring, control and surveillance of fisheries resources including conducting frame, stock and catch assessment surveys
    • Identifying critical habitats and seasons for designing appropriate protection strategies
    • Monitoring fish habitats for pollutants
    • Carrying out, diagnosis, prevention and control of fish diseases
    • Enforcing compliance of regulatory measures including licensing, closed seasons and slot sizes
    • Promoting fish marketing and value addition.

    Requirements

    • Bachelors degree in any of the following fields; Fisheries, Zoology, Aquatic Sciences, Natural Resource Management, Biochemistry, Food Sciences and Technology, Environmental Sciences, Biological Sciences, Physical Sciences, Chemistry or any other equivalent qualifications from a recognized institution
    • Minimum Seven (7) years work experience
    • Certificate in computer applications skills from recognized institution.
    • Knowledge of Fisheries development and management policies, Fisheries Act and other related Acts
